About Heidi Jacobs
Heidi Jacobs is a scholar working on Nutrition and Dietetics, Molecular Biology, Food Science, Genetics and Gastroenterology, having authored 13 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microbial Metabolites in Food Biotechnology (11 papers), Digestive system and related health (3 papers), Probiotics and Fermented Foods (3 papers), Gastrointestinal motility and disorders (2 papers), Gut microbiota and health (2 papers), Coenzyme Q10 studies and effects (1 paper), Vitamin K Research Studies (1 paper) and Muscle metabolism and nutrition (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Nutrition and Dietetics (643 citations), Gastroenterology (94 citations), Food Science (320 citations),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(110 citations) and Physiology (156 citations). Heidi Jacobs has collaborated with scholars based in France, Belgium and China. Frequent co-authors include Willy Verstraete, Nico Boon, Tom Van de Wiele, Sam Possemiers, C. Fougnies, Flore Dépeint, Jean‐Michel Lecerf, Larbi Rhazi, Philippe Pouillart and Hassan Younes. Their work appears in journals such as Nutrients, International Journal of Food Sciences and Nutrition, FEMS Microbiology Ecology,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ry and European Journal of Nutrition.
